[Telepathy-commits] [telepathy-salut/master] change connection status to disconnected and not connecting if salut_contact_manager_start failed

Guillaume Desmottes guillaume.desmottes at collabora.co.uk
Wed Nov 26 04:34:45 PST 2008


---
 src/salut-connection.c |    5 ++---
 1 files changed, 2 insertions(+), 3 deletions(-)

diff --git a/src/salut-connection.c b/src/salut-connection.c
index 74434cd..2b374f3 100644
--- a/src/salut-connection.c
+++ b/src/salut-connection.c
@@ -880,10 +880,9 @@ _self_established_cb (SalutSelf *s, gpointer data)
 
   if (!salut_contact_manager_start (priv->contact_manager, NULL))
     {
-      /* FIXME handle error */
       tp_base_connection_change_status ( TP_BASE_CONNECTION (base),
-          TP_CONNECTION_STATUS_CONNECTING,
-          TP_CONNECTION_STATUS_REASON_REQUESTED);
+          TP_CONNECTION_STATUS_DISCONNECTED,
+          TP_CONNECTION_STATUS_REASON_NETWORK_ERROR);
       return;
   }
 
-- 
1.5.6.5




More information about the Telepathy-commits mailing list